Shooting Claims Life of Man in Northeast Portland’s Argay Terrace; Investigators Seek Leads

Portland, Oregon — A shooting in the Argay Terrace neighborhood claimed a man’s life on Monday evening, marking another grim incident in the city. Police responded to reports of gunfire in the 4500 block of Northeast 125th Place around 5:35 p.m.

Upon arriving, officers discovered a man suffering from critical gunshot wounds. Despite the immediate first aid provided by police officers at the scene, the victim succumbed to his injuries en route to a local hospital. Authorities have not yet released the name of the victim as investigations are ongoing.

According to the Portland Police Bureau, the shooter or shooters fled the scene prior to the officers’ arrival, and no arrests have been reported so far. The investigation is still active, and police are urging anyone with information to come forward. They can reach out via email at homicidetips@police.portlandor or call 503-823-0479, referencing case number 25-295320.

If confirmed as a homicide, this incident would mark the 38th this year in Portland. In contrast, the city had reported 64 homicides by this time last year, highlighting a troubling trend in gun violence.
